    The Role of Betting Systems in High Stakes Roulette

    Betting systems like the Martingale, Fibonacci, and D’Alembert are popular among roulette players, but their effectiveness at high stakes is limited. The Martingale system, which involves doubling your bet after each loss, can quickly hit table limits or deplete a bankroll during a long losing streak. For example, starting with a $1,000 bet, a series of eight consecutive losses would require a $256,000 wager on the ninth spin – far beyond most table limits.

    What Sets French Roulette Gold Apart

    The core difference lies in the table layout and the rules that govern the game. Unlike American roulette, which has a double zero (00) and a single zero (0), French Roulette Gold uses only a single zero. This immediately cuts the house edge in half for most bets. But the French variant goes further with two unique features: La Partage and En Prison.

    La Partage is the rule that returns half of any even-money bet (red/black, odd/even, high/low) when the ball lands on zero. This effectively reduces the house edge on those bets to 1.35%. En Prison, while less common in online versions, allows the bet to stay on the table for the next spin. The “Gold” designation in the online version typically refers to enhanced graphics, a high-quality user interface, and smooth gameplay optimized for US players.

    The House Edge Advantage for US Players

    When you compare the three main roulette variants available to American players, the numbers speak for themselves. American roulette carries a 5.26% house edge on all bets except the five-number bet (which is even worse). European roulette offers a 2.70% house edge. French Roulette Gold, with the La Partage rule, drops the edge to 1.35% on even-money wagers.

    For a US player making $100 in even-money bets over 100 spins, the expected loss on American roulette is about $5.26. On French Roulette Gold, that loss drops to roughly $1.35. Over time, this difference can have a significant impact on your bankroll. Many experienced players in the US seek out French Roulette Gold specifically for this mathematical advantage.

    The American Wheel and Its Distinct Flavor

    What sets roulette in the United States apart from its European cousin is the double-zero pocket. The American wheel features 38 numbered slots: 1 through 36, a single zero, and a double zero. This extra pocket shifts the house edge to 5.26% on most bets, compared to the 2.70% edge found on European wheels. For players in states like Pennsylvania, Michigan, and West Virginia where regulated online casinos operate, understanding this distinction is key to making informed wagers.

    The layout of the American table also differs slightly, with the double zero positioned at the top of the betting grid. This design has been a fixture in U.S. casinos since the 19th century, and it carries over seamlessly into the digital realm. When you load an online roulette session, you will recognize the familiar arrangement of inside bets – straight up, split, street – and outside bets like red/black or odd/even. The game remains true to its roots while offering features impossible on a physical table.

    Betting Options and Payouts at a Glance

    Understanding the payouts on the American wheel helps you tailor your risk. Inside bets offer higher payouts but lower odds, while outside bets provide better chances of winning but smaller returns. The table below outlines the most common wagers and their corresponding payouts. Morningstar

    Bet Type Description Payout
    Straight Up Bet on a single number 35 to 1
    Split Bet on two adjacent numbers 17 to 1
    Street Bet on three numbers in a row 11 to 1
    Corner Bet on four numbers forming a square 8 to 1
    Red/Black Bet on the color of the winning number 1 to 1
    Odd/Even Bet on whether the number is odd or even 1 to 1
    1-18 or 19-36 Bet on the low or high half of the numbers 1 to 1

    Another popular wager is the five-number bet on 0, 00, 1, 2, and 3. This bet carries a house edge of 7.89%, making it the least favorable on the table. Experienced players often avoid it. The American wheel also allows for call bets, such as Voisins du Zéro and Tiers du Cylindre, which are more common in European variations but are available on some U.S. platforms.
